/有一个具有两道作业的批处理系统,作业调度采用短作业优先的调度算法,进程调度采用以优先数为基础的抢占式调度(优先数小者优先级高)有如下作业序列: 给出各作业在内存中运行的起止时间;计算平均周转时间和平均带权周转时间。  10.00   A到达内存,直接进入就绪态,处理机空闲...
原创 2022-11-08 23:45:08
1005阅读
概念Hive 是一个构建在 Hadoop 之上的数据仓库,它可以将结构化的数据文件映射成表,并提供类 SQL 查询功能,用于查询的 SQL 语句会被转化为 MapReduce 作业,然后提交到 Hadoop 上运行。Hive处理的数据存储在HDFS,Hive分析数据底层的实现是MapReduce,执行程序运行在Yarn上。 注:Hive的执行延迟比较高,因此Hive常用于数据分析,对实时性要求不高
转载 2023-07-20 20:01:01
197阅读
给定n个作业的集合J={J1,J2,…,Jn}。每一个作业有两项任务分别在两台机器上完成。每个作业必须先由机器1处理,再由机器2处理。作业Ji需要机器j的处理时间为tji,i=1,2,…n,j=1,2。对于一个确定的作业调度,设Fji是作业i在机器j上完成处理的时间。则所有作业在机器2上完成处理的时
原创 2022-06-27 19:53:06
295阅读
       Linux的两大抽象分别是进程和文件,其它一切操作都是基于或者针对这两大抽象而进行的。如何设计并实现一个最佳的进程调度器,则是所有操作系统都必须重点关注的。本文基于《Modern Operating Systems》(Andrew S.Tanenbaum)一书,对批处理系统、交互式系统(UNIX
原创 2012-07-17 17:47:05
1881阅读
则所有作业在机器2上完成处理时间和f=F2i,称为该作业调度的完成时间和2、简单描述   对于给定的n个作业,指定最佳作业调度方案,使其完成时间和达到最小...
问题描述    给定 n 个作业的集合 j = {j1, j2, ..., jn}。每一个作业 j[i] 都有两项任务分别在两台机器上完成。每一个作业必须先由机器1 处理,然后由机器2处理。作业 j[i] 需要机器 j 的处理时间为 t[j][i] ,其中i = 1, 2, ..., n, j = 1, 2。对于一个确
转载 精选 2016-04-28 17:05:52
2692阅读
批处理作业调度
原创 2018-12-06 23:46:17
1764阅读
1、问题描述每一个作业Ji都有两项任务分别在2台机器上完成。每个作业必须先有机器1处理,然后再由机器2处理。作业Ji需要机器j的处理时间为tji。对于一个确定的作业调度,设Fji是作业i在机器j上完成处理时间。则所有作业在机器2上完成处理时间和f=F2i,称为该作业调度的完成时间和2、简单描述对于给定的n个作业,指定最佳作业调度方案,使其完成时间和达到最小。区别于流水线调度问题:批处理作业调度旨在
原创 2022-07-13 09:45:59
445阅读
批处理作业调度-分支界限法
原创 2018-12-07 23:10:14
1624阅读
批处理系统(batch processing system)中,一个作业可以长时间地占用cpu。而分时系统中,一个作业只能在一个时间片(Time Slice,一般取100ms)的时间内使用cpu。批处不是严格意义上的操作系统,虽然可用Monitor监督,可用汇编语言开发,但也只是操作系统的原型。所谓批处理(batch processing )就是将作业按照它们的性质分组(或分批),然后将成组(或成
在win8以前的系统,我们在用bat的方式安装服务时,直接用下面的语句就可以了:%windir%\Microsoft.NET\Framework\v4.0.30319\InstallUtil.exe xxxx.Service.exe net start xxxx pause但是在win8以后的系统系统对程序的权限要求有所提升,如果还用上面的命令,则会提示需要管理员权限,如果右键以管理员权限运行吧
转载 2023-07-03 10:05:08
140阅读
Kubernetes(K8S)是当今最流行的容器编排系统之一,其强大的调度功能能够帮助开发者高效地管理容器应用。批处理调度是K8S中非常重要的一部分,它能够帮助我们有效地调度批处理任务,比如定时任务、数据处理等。在这篇文章中,我将向你介绍如何在K8S中实现批处理调度。 首先,让我们了解一下K8S中批处理调度的基本流程: | 步骤 | 描述 | |------|------
原创 2024-04-11 11:22:52
35阅读
最近看Spring,发现Spring有任务调度管理功能,能很好地解决以上的问题。于是我们决定将定时程序迁移到Spring中。下面就结合我们这次程序的迁移,介绍一下如何使用Spring的任务调度。在讨论Spring的任务调度前,我们先谈谈Spring。仔细探究Spring,你会发现很多有趣的东西。第一,Spring中并没有多少新技术,就如AOP这些概念,其实于上个****早已存在了。 MS的操作系统
1、问题描述 每一个作业Ji都有两项任务分别在2台机器上完成。每个作业必须先有机器1处理,然后再由机器2处理。作业Ji需要机器j的处理时间为tji。对于一个确定的作业调度,设Fji是作业i在机器j上完成处理时间。则所有作业在机器2上完成处理时间和f是指把F2i将i从1-n求和,称为该作业调度的完成时
原创 2022-05-27 23:03:04
773阅读
Kubernetes (K8S) 是一种用于自动化部署、扩展和管理容器化应用程序的开源平台。在K8S中,批处理任务调度是非常重要的一个功能,它可以帮助我们在集群中调度执行批处理任务,如数据处理、ETL作业等。下面我们来详细介绍如何实现K8S批处理任务调度。 ### K8S批处理任务调度流程 | 步骤 | 操作 | | :--- | :--- | | 1 | 创建一个批处理任务 | | 2 |
原创 2024-04-10 11:48:11
56阅读
单道批处理系统:为了实现对作业的连续处理,需要先把一批作业以脱机方式输入到磁盘上,并在系统中配上监督程序(Monitor),在它的控制下,使得这批作业能一个接着一个的连续工作。具体的工作过程是首先由监督程序将磁带上的第一个作业装入内存,并把运行控制权交给作业;该作业处理完时,又把控制权交给监督程序,再有监督程序把磁带的第二个作业调入内存等等。可以看成是串行的。优点:解决人机矛盾和CPU与IO设备速
批处理程序生成计划DataSet API所编写的批处理程序跟DataStream API所编写的流处理程序在生成作业图(JobGraph)之前的实现差别很大。流处理程序是生成流图(StreamGraph),而批处理程序是生成计划(Plan)并由优化器对其进行优化并生成优化后的计划(OptimizedPlan)。什么是计划计划(Plan)以数据流(dataflow)的形式来表示批处理程序,但它只是批
电脑用久了,系统分区内肯定会有很多垃圾文件,占据着大量空间,严重影响系统运行速度,这个程序能自动清理电脑里的垃圾而不会破坏系统。        1. 在桌面上点鼠标右键,新建一个文本文件,把下面的字复制进去:@echo offecho 正在清除系统垃圾文件,请稍等......del /f /s /q %systemdrive%\
转载 精选 2010-03-18 21:39:51
583阅读
批处理(Batch Processing)操作系统的工作方式是:用户将作业交给系统操作员,系统操作员将许多用户的作业组成一批作业,之后输入到计算机中,在系统中形成一个自动转接的连续的作业流,然后启动操作系统系统自动、依次执行每个作业。最后由操作员将作业结果交给用户。    批处理操作系统的特点是:多道和成批处理
转载 精选 2011-06-15 11:29:19
371阅读
为最终计划应用范围分区重写Flink的批处理程序允许用户使用partitionByRange API来基于某个(或某些)字段进行按范围分区且可以选择性地指定排序顺序,示例代码如下:final ExecutionEnvironment env = ExecutionEnvironment.getExecutionEnvironment(); final DataSet<Tuple2<I
  • 1
  • 2
  • 3
  • 4
  • 5